Moving Tips From Our Crew

  • Declutter before you pack. Donating or selling what you no longer use is the fastest way to cut both your shipment size and your moving cost.
  • A little prep goes a long way: label boxes by room, keep essentials (chargers, meds, documents) in a separate bag, and defrost the fridge 24 hours before pickup.

How much does it cost to move from Union to Portland?

Cost depends on the size of your shipment and the distance between Union, NJ and Portland, ME. The Interstate Movers prices long-distance moves per cubic foot plus a drive/fuel component. Use the free calculator on this page for an instant, no-obligation range — most NJ-to-ME moves land between $1,500 and $6,000.

How far in advance should I book movers for the Union to Portland move?

For peak-season long-distance moves (summer and end-of-month), book 4–6 weeks ahead. Off-season, 2–3 weeks is usually enough. Booking early also gives you the best pickup window.

Weather & Climate in Portland

Portland, ME averages about 82°F for the July high and around 12°F for the January low, with roughly 45.4 inches of precipitation a year. Packing for the local climate — and knowing what to expect season to season — makes settling into Portland much easier.
